Abstract
The three ternary Gd3+-p-sulfonatothiacalix[4]arene-tetramethylammonium complexes formed in aqueous solutions at pH 4-10 have 1:1:1 stoichiometry and enhanced stability due to Gd3+ coordination via phenolate groups at the lower rim and tetramethylammonium included into the cavity through the upper rim.
